There was in the Middle Ages a Spanish RC Jesuit trained theologian by the name of Ludovicus Alcasar (1554-1613) who established a system of prophetic interpretation which became known as `Preterism' - the idea that the end time prophecies we discuss here and elsewhere, all belong into the time of Antiochus Epiphanes IV. (175-164) in order to free the papacy from the idea that it was the antichrist.

Another RC theologian from Spain by the name of Francesco Rivera, developed a system of prophetic interpretation we know today as `Futurism'. Both of these systems of interpretation tried to rid the papacy of the view that it was the antichrist as the reformers taught it during those years. They achieved their objective by teaching Preterism and/or Futurism in their schools of learning for centuries, thus switching the historical interpretations (i.e. Luther), to another place and time. From then on people could not `see' that these Bible prophecies were fulfilled with Rome. They changed during these 1260 years the "times", God's prophetic calendar.

The Prophet Elijah

Before we close we must take into account some interesting remarks which have to do with the `false prophet' in Revelation. We want to explain that phrase more closely from the Bible. The power which is called the `false prophet' in Revelation, we discover, is trying to counterfeit the work of a true prophet we read about in the Bible.

How is that possible?

The Bible also says that the `land beast', which is called the `false prophet', is going to cause "fire to come down from heaven on the earth in the sight of men" Rev. 13:13.

Which prophet in the Bible does that remind us of?

It reminds us of Elijah.

Therefore, this `false prophet' in Revelation 16:13 must be a counterfeit prophet Elijah, - which means that if you know what the real Elijah preached you will know what the false Elijah is going to preach in advance.

Who were Elijah's enemies and how many were there?

Elijah had three enemies:

(1) King Ahab, the civil ruler; (2) a harlot by the name of Jezebel, who, the Bible says, was involved in witchcraft and she committed fornication with King Ahab, (2.Kings 9:22), besides being a harlot. She does all the maneuvering for the impassive King Ahab to fulfill her desire to kill Elijah.; (3) the false prophets of the sungod Baal who were the preachers for Jezebel.
